Krone C

Built: 2008-2009 · Series: Trailers over 10 t (Class O4)

The C comes from Krone. Production: 2008-2009. The machine is 6,950 mm long and 2,530 mm wide. The unladen weight is 3,250 kg. The wheelbase measures 5,550 mm. Top speed is 100 km/h. The gross vehicle weight is 34,000 kg. The machine runs on 4 wheels. Unladen weight across the Krone range ranges from 1,300 to 24,000 kg; the C sits at the bottom of that range with 3,250 kg. What to check before buying

  • Search the frame and welds at the axle mounts — that is where cracks start.
  • Check the brakes and the last inspection in the papers.
  • Work the gross weight against the towing vehicle before buying.
  • Compare the chassis number with the papers.
  • Look at the floor, cover or body from the inside — rust does not show from outside.

A general list for this type of machine — no substitute for an inspection or an appraiser.
